Andrew Lloyd Webber’s production company rebrands; ‘Cats: The Jellicle Ball’ will open on Broadway
The Really Useful Group (RUG), the production company of Tony Award-winning composer, writer and producer Andrew Lloyd Webber, has rebranded. As of Aug. 13, the company is known as LW Entertainment, and will continue to manage Lloyd Webber’s oeuvre of works, which includes “The Phantom of the Opera,” “Cats,” “Jesus Christ Superstar,” “Joseph and the Amazing Technicolor Dreamcoat,” “Evita,” Sunset Boulevard” and “Starlight Express.”LW Entertainme…
